Importance of Winter Boots for Children

Having the right footwear is crucial for winter activities, especially for children. Winter boots offer several benefits that regular shoes or sneakers cannot provide. Firstly, they keep your child’s feet warm and cozy, protecting them from the cold and preventing frostbite. The insulation in winter boots helps retain heat, ensuring your child’s feet stay comfortable even in freezing temperatures.

Secondly, winter boots are designed to be waterproof or water-resistant, keeping your child’s feet dry and preventing moisture from seeping in. Complicated matters like cold-related discomfort can arise from wet feet. 

With winter boots, your child can enjoy playing in the snow or walking through slush without worrying about wet socks or damp shoes.

Lastly, winter boots offer greater traction and grip, which lowers the possibility of slipping and falling on ice surfaces. These boots’ outsoles are designed to provide stability and protect against accidents.

 Whether your child builds a snowman or runs around in the backyard, winter boots ensure their feet stay firmly on the ground.

Factors to Consider When Buying Winter Boots for Children

Selecting the best pair of winter boots for your child might be difficult. To make the decision easier, here are some factors to consider:

  • Insulation: Look for boots with high-quality insulation materials such as Thinsulate or synthetic fibers. These materials provide excellent warmth and comfort without adding bulk to the shoes.
  • Waterproofing: Make sure the boots stop water from getting inside. This helps keep your kid’s feet dry when they walk in snow or slush.
  • Fit and Comfort: Opt for boots that offer a snug fit without being too tight. Look for adjustable closures or laces that allow for a customized fit. Additionally, padded collars and cushioned insoles provide extra comfort for your child’s feet.
  • Durability: Find boots that can handle lots of running and playing outside. Look for ones made of tough stuff like nylon or leather, with extra-strong stitching and tough bottoms.
  • Style: While functionality is crucial, your child will also appreciate stylish boots. Look for boots with fun colors, patterns, or designs that your child will love.

Think about these things to find the best winter boots your child likes that work well for them.

Different Types of Winter Boots for Children

Winter boots look different in many ways, each suited for various winter activities. Here are some popular types of children’s winter boots:

  • Snow Boots: Snow boots are designed for heavy snowfall and extreme cold temperatures. They are often insulated and have a waterproof upper to keep feet warm and dry. Snow boots typically have a high shaft that provides extra protection and helps to keep snow out.
  • Hiking Boots: Hiking boots are awesome if your kid loves going on winter hikes or playing outside. They help them walk on slippery ground and stay comfy and dry because they’re tough and stop water from getting in.
  • Casual Boots: Winter boots are versatile and can be worn for everyday activities. They balance style and functionality, making them suitable for school, outings, or casual winter walks. These boots often have a mid-height shaft and provide good insulation and waterproofing.
  • Winter Sports Boots: Specialized sports boots are essential for children who love winter sports like skiing or snowboarding. These boots are designed with specific features such as ankle support, rigid soles, and compatibility with bindings. They provide the necessary protection and support for high-impact winter activities.

Knowing the kinds of winter boots helps you pick the best one for your child’s needs and likes to do.

How to Choose the Right Size of Winter Boots for Children

Finding the right size of winter boots for your child is essential to ensure a comfortable fit and optimal performance. Here are some tips to help you choose the correct size:

  • Measure their feet: First, measure their feet with a tape or ruler. Check both feet, as one might be a bit bigger.
  • Check the width: Also, think about how wide their feet are. Some boots have different widths for wider or narrower feet.
  • Consider growth room: Remember to leave some space for them to grow. A thumb’s width between their longest toe and the front of the boot is good.
  • Read reviews and sizing charts: Look for customer reviews or refer to the brand’s sizing chart to understand how the boots fit. This can be particularly helpful if you are purchasing online.
  • Try them on: If possible, have your child try on the boots before purchasing. This allows them to test the fit, ensure the boots are comfortable, and provide adequate support.

Remember that children’s feet can grow quickly, so it’s important to check the size regularly and replace the boots when they become too small.

Tips for Keeping Children’s Winter Boots in Good Condition

To make your child’s winter boots last longer and maintain their performance, here are some tips for care and maintenance:

  • Cleaning: Clean the boots by brushing off dirt, salt, and other yucky stuff with a soft brush or cloth. If the boots are particularly dirty, use mild soap and water and rinse thoroughly.
  • Drying: Let the boots dry by themselves after using them. Please don’t put them close to heaters or radiators because that can ruin them.
  • Conditioning: Regularly apply a waterproofing or conditioning spray to the boots to enhance their water resistance and protect the materials. Do what the instructions from the manufacturer say to get the best results.
  • Storage: When not in use, store the winter boots in a cool, dry place away from sunlight. Don’t squash or bend the boots because that can wreck how they look and how they’re made.

If you do these things to take care of the boots, they’ll last longer and keep your kid’s feet safe and cozy for a long time.

Safety Features to Look for in Children’s Winter Boots

When choosing winter boots for your child, it’s essential to prioritize safety. Here are some important safety features to look for:

  • Good Traction: Opt for boots with outsoles that provide excellent traction, especially on slippery surfaces. Look for deep lugs or patterns that offer better grip and stability.
  • Reflective Details: Boots with reflective accents or patches enhance visibility, especially during low-light conditions. This improves safety when walking near roads or in dimly lit areas.
  • Ankle Support: Boots with good ankle support help prevent ankle twists or injuries, particularly during active winter activities. Look for boots with higher shafts or reinforced ankle areas.
  • Secure Closures: Ensure the boots have secure closures, such as adjustable straps, laces, or buckles. This prevents the boots from slipping off or becoming loose during play.
  • Padded Collars and Tongues: Boots with padded collars and tongues provide extra comfort and help prevent chafing or irritation.

By choosing winter boots with these safety features, you can ensure that your child’s feet are protected and their winter adventures are worry-free.
